        Congratulations, keroppi, on your DS success at RI.


        Students with COs/WLs need to decide on their choice only around 24 to 28 Oct. For kids with more than one CO, even if the kid/parent have written in to reject the CO, I don't think the school will give up the place to another child on WL before 24 to 28 Oct - as in, to inform the WL child via officially that he/she is no longer on waitlist but given a CO.

        At best, with knowledge of how many kids are likely to reject the offer (like NYGH Principal who asked those with CO but intending to reject NYGH to write in), the school can better manage the expectation of those on waitlist.

        My friends whose DSs had successfully DSA for HCl before, told me that the Principal assured them that those on Waitlist 1 is almost as good as a CO as alot of the boys with COs from HCI also had COs from RI.

              cylg:
              jtoh:



              That's why I say that there are likely to be more students struggling at the higher levels at NUSH compared to other top IP schools, because of NUSH' accelerated programme.

              huh?!....u mean all nush students have to take the accelerated prog har?

              NUSH is a specialized independent school, as are SOTA and Singapore Sports School. They're for those who are very talented in their fields. And yes, everyone in NUSH does an accelerated programme in Math and Science compared to the other schools. A few exceptional students even do university modules.
